Home
last modified time | relevance | path

Searched refs:sign_bits (Results 1 – 4 of 4) sorted by relevance

/external/libvpx/libvpx/vpx_dsp/x86/
Dhighbd_idct16x16_add_sse2.c23 __m128i min_input, max_input, temp1, temp2, sign_bits; in vpx_highbd_idct16x16_256_add_sse2() local
71 sign_bits = _mm_cmplt_epi16(inptr[i], zero); in vpx_highbd_idct16x16_256_add_sse2()
72 temp1 = _mm_unpacklo_epi16(inptr[i], sign_bits); in vpx_highbd_idct16x16_256_add_sse2()
73 temp2 = _mm_unpackhi_epi16(inptr[i], sign_bits); in vpx_highbd_idct16x16_256_add_sse2()
76 sign_bits = _mm_cmplt_epi16(inptr[i + 16], zero); in vpx_highbd_idct16x16_256_add_sse2()
77 temp1 = _mm_unpacklo_epi16(inptr[i + 16], sign_bits); in vpx_highbd_idct16x16_256_add_sse2()
78 temp2 = _mm_unpackhi_epi16(inptr[i + 16], sign_bits); in vpx_highbd_idct16x16_256_add_sse2()
135 __m128i min_input, max_input, temp1, temp2, sign_bits; in vpx_highbd_idct16x16_10_add_sse2() local
188 sign_bits = _mm_cmplt_epi16(inptr[i], zero); in vpx_highbd_idct16x16_10_add_sse2()
189 temp1 = _mm_unpacklo_epi16(inptr[i], sign_bits); in vpx_highbd_idct16x16_10_add_sse2()
[all …]
Dhighbd_idct4x4_add_sse2.c23 __m128i sign_bits[2]; in vpx_highbd_idct4x4_16_add_sse2() local
62 sign_bits[0] = _mm_cmplt_epi16(inptr[0], zero); in vpx_highbd_idct4x4_16_add_sse2()
63 sign_bits[1] = _mm_cmplt_epi16(inptr[1], zero); in vpx_highbd_idct4x4_16_add_sse2()
64 inptr[3] = _mm_unpackhi_epi16(inptr[1], sign_bits[1]); in vpx_highbd_idct4x4_16_add_sse2()
65 inptr[2] = _mm_unpacklo_epi16(inptr[1], sign_bits[1]); in vpx_highbd_idct4x4_16_add_sse2()
66 inptr[1] = _mm_unpackhi_epi16(inptr[0], sign_bits[0]); in vpx_highbd_idct4x4_16_add_sse2()
67 inptr[0] = _mm_unpacklo_epi16(inptr[0], sign_bits[0]); in vpx_highbd_idct4x4_16_add_sse2()
Dhighbd_idct8x8_add_sse2.c23 __m128i min_input, max_input, temp1, temp2, sign_bits; in vpx_highbd_idct8x8_64_add_sse2() local
68 sign_bits = _mm_cmplt_epi16(inptr[i], zero); in vpx_highbd_idct8x8_64_add_sse2()
69 temp1 = _mm_unpackhi_epi16(inptr[i], sign_bits); in vpx_highbd_idct8x8_64_add_sse2()
70 temp2 = _mm_unpacklo_epi16(inptr[i], sign_bits); in vpx_highbd_idct8x8_64_add_sse2()
122 __m128i min_input, max_input, temp1, temp2, sign_bits; in vpx_highbd_idct8x8_12_add_sse2() local
170 sign_bits = _mm_cmplt_epi16(inptr[i], zero); in vpx_highbd_idct8x8_12_add_sse2()
171 temp1 = _mm_unpackhi_epi16(inptr[i], sign_bits); in vpx_highbd_idct8x8_12_add_sse2()
172 temp2 = _mm_unpacklo_epi16(inptr[i], sign_bits); in vpx_highbd_idct8x8_12_add_sse2()
Dfwd_txfm_sse2.h249 const __m128i sign_bits = _mm_cmplt_epi16(*poutput, zero); in store_output() local
250 __m128i out0 = _mm_unpacklo_epi16(*poutput, sign_bits); in store_output()
251 __m128i out1 = _mm_unpackhi_epi16(*poutput, sign_bits); in store_output()
262 const __m128i sign_bits = _mm_cmplt_epi16(*poutput, zero); in storeu_output() local
263 __m128i out0 = _mm_unpacklo_epi16(*poutput, sign_bits); in storeu_output()
264 __m128i out1 = _mm_unpackhi_epi16(*poutput, sign_bits); in storeu_output()